Flipping the track polarity AND the throttle polarity will cancel each other out. Your reverse loop polarity would be unchanged.
I think that the CTI Electronics Train Brain system works by essentially having a computer controlled block assignment system that assigns a throttle to the occupied block and the one ahead. It tracks the direction of travel by monitoring the polarity of the track, but it’s basically an on/off relay coupled to a throttle routing relay... if I understand the literature.
I just received a reply from CTI, and it appears you don’t have to “program” their system if you use RR&Co Traincontroller software to control the CTI system. So the choice is basically Smart Layout vs Smart Locos. Since it would cost about $50 per loco to install DCC decoder or $12.50 to control each “block” on the railroad if I’m reading the CTI manual correctly. The sensor costs are comparable for DCC & CTI, so it’s going to depend on the number of locos vs number of layout blocks.
One thing I did not see in your analysis is the number of locomotives that "could" be operated at one time. With DCC even a minimal system will give you more than 8 locomotives at one time, to control up to 8 locomotives at one time with a traditional cab system you are talking 8 power supplies / throttles and a 8 position double stack rotary switch (last time i looked (1996) the switches were about $14.00 each.
